The champion’s return is near! On Monday (28) it will be time to celebrate Curitiba’s gastronomy champions in 2023 at 13th Good Gourmet Award, presented by Gold Food Service. The party starts at 7 pm and will be broadcast live on Bom Gourmet’s Instagram from 9 pm. This year, the most traditional gastronomic award in the capital of Paraná will recognize the best gastronomic establishments in the city in more than 50 categories. The result will be released from 11 pm on the website www.premiobomgourmet.com.br and on People’s Gazette.

About the 2023 Bom Gourmet Award

This year’s Prize is the biggest in history. With 28 categories in the Popular Flavor stage – whose basis is the public’s nomination and vote on their favorite establishments. There are flavors for all tastes. Check out this year’s categories below:

Hot dogs, Cafeteria, Confectionery, Japanese food restaurant, Pizzeria, Rural restaurant, Pasta, Bread and dumplings, Jaguar meat, Coxinha, Feijoada, French bread, Sandwiches, Buffet by the kilo, Bar, Vegetarian Restaurant, Executive Lunch, Restaurant Arabic food, Brazilian regional food restaurant, Martha Rocha, Crackling, Ribs, Sonho/Donuts, Ice cream, Pastel, Gourmet market, Pet friendly space and Gastronomy that Transforms.

The latter, a novelty in the Sabor Popular stage, in partnership with Clube da Alice, one of the main digital communities of female entrepreneurs. A committee selected five stories of initiatives by women entrepreneurs in gastronomy who were members of the Club and who had registered. Then, the public elected the champion via voting on the Award’s website.

Another traditional stage of the Bom Gourmet Award is Especialidades, which brings together juries made up of consumers and opinion makers. In 2023 there are 15 categories: Best Restaurant, Complete Menu, 5 Star Chef, Best Wine List, Brunch, Seafood, Oriental, Specialty Coffee, Artisan Bread, Meat House, Gluten-free Local Product, Places to Buy Wine, Authorial Drink, Artisan Brewery from Paraná and Local Producer.

The Bom Gourmet Committee, which praises and honors gastronomy personalities and businesses from the perspective of a group of recognizedly specialized professionals, elected champions in five categories: Novelties, Restauranteur, Sommelier, 2023 Honorees and To keep an eye on. The Bom Gourmet Committee was also responsible for highlighting the Curitibanices, a category that looked at behaviors and gastronomic ventures that translate our city. But the triumphant return of a champion calls for extra doses of emotion. For this reason, the organization presents in 2023 special categories, developed with partners.

The Erasto Gaertner category, in which chefs developed recipes focused on shared health and nutrition values ​​evidenced by the hospital’s Nutrition Service; and Sustainable Business Models, a partnership with Composta+, which seeks to highlight establishments that reproduce good practices related to sustainability.

Still within the special categories, the Bom Gourmet Award once again establishes a partnership with the HAUS architecture and design platform, to elect the spaces that best combine gastronomy and architectural and design experience. It is the HAUS Ambiance category.

The event takes place in one of the city’s icons: the Wire Opera, unique in beauty and full of symbolism. From the choice of location, the organization seeks to reinforce the connection and proximity of Bom Gourmet with the city. “Curitiba turned 330 this year and nothing fairer than taking our party to a setting that speaks so much to the city. For this reason, the Ópera was chosen to be the stage for the great meeting of talents and flavors of Curitiba’s gastronomy”, explains Caroline.

The champion’s return is reflected in the way the structure will be organized and assembled. And here goes one spoiler: the winners of each category will lift the trophy literally in the center of the event, as the stage will be moved to a ring that can be seen from different angles of the party, offering a 360º perspective to those present. Andréa creates suspense: “When we talk about Ópera de Arame, people already automatically refer to its internal classic format, but the party will give it a completely different and unprecedented format”.
